Understanding the TikTok Algorithm

The TikTok algorithm is a complex system that determines the visibility of content on the platform, significantly influencing a creator’s ability to gain followers in Canada. Understanding this algorithm is essential for those looking to create viral content. The algorithm primarily operates on a recommendation system that takes into account various factors to curate a user’s ‘For You’ page.

One of the key components of the TikTok algorithm is user interaction. This includes likes, shares, comments, and the duration a viewer spends watching a video. High interaction rates signal to the algorithm that content is engaging, which increases its chances of being shown to a wider audience. As such, creators in Canada should aim to encourage interactions by engaging with their followers and prompting them to comment or share their content.

Video engagement is another critical factor that affects visibility. Elements such as video completion rates and replays play a significant role in determining how often a video is promoted on other users’ feeds. Creators should strive for high-quality content that captures viewers’ attention immediately, thereby increasing the likelihood of full views and replays. Additionally, using popular sounds or trending challenges can significantly enhance viewer retention, tapping into the culture that exists within the TikTok community.

Trending topics also greatly impact the TikTok algorithm. In Canada, staying updated on trending hashtags and themes ensures that content stays relevant, fostering increased visibility. Creators who actively participate in challenges or incorporate trending sounds often enjoy greater reach as they align their content with what is currently capturing audience interest.

By understanding and leveraging these factors, Canadian creators can optimize their TikTok presence to maximize reach and engagement.

Crafting Engaging Content

Creating viral content on TikTok requires a deep understanding of what resonates with the platform’s audience. Notably, storytelling, humor, and educational videos are among the most effective content types that cultivate viewer engagement. By integrating these elements into your videos, you can significantly increase your chances of going viral.

To start, consider the power of a captivating hook. The initial few seconds of your video are crucial; they determine whether viewers will continue watching or scroll past. Powerful hooks can take various forms—provocative questions, surprising statements, or intriguing visuals. For instance, beginning with an eye-catching clip that highlights a unique aspect of your video can entice viewers and encourage them to keep watching.

Maintaining viewer interest is equally important. This can be achieved by pacing your content effectively and using dynamic visuals and sounds to capture attention. Utilizing transitions, engaging captions, and effects can enhance interaction and keep viewers engaged throughout the duration of your video. Additionally, fostering a sense of community and connection with your audience may involve responding to comments or weaving viewer feedback into your content, thereby establishing a more personal bond.

Finally, crafting compelling narratives can elevate your content. This includes developing relatable characters or scenarios that resonate with your audience’s experiences or emotions. Incorporating elements of surprise or a twist in the narrative can significantly increase watch time. Therefore, focus on structuring your videography around a progression that captivates viewers enough to encourage shares and likes, which further promotes your content to a wider audience.

Posting Strategy and Timing

To effectively create viral content on TikTok Canada, a well-planned posting strategy and timing are crucial for maximizing reach and engagement. TikTok’s algorithm favors consistency, so developing a regular posting schedule can significantly enhance visibility. A general recommendation is to post at least once daily, as this keeps your content fresh and ensures that your audience remains engaged. However, the frequency can be adjusted based on audience response and the quality of content produced.

Understanding the optimal times to post is essential. Various studies suggest that the best times to engage with TikTok users can vary; however, early morning and late evening typically yield better results as users are most active during these periods. Analyzing insights provided by TikTok can also aid in determining when your specific audience is online. TikTok’s analytics tool displays metrics regarding follower activity, enabling content creators to identify peak engagement times effectively.

Additionally, creating a content calendar can help in planning the type of content shared alongside its posting times. This method not only aids in maintaining consistency but also allows for a diverse range of posts, catering to different segments of the audience. Furthermore, experimenting with different posting times and analyzing engagement rates can provide valuable data to refine your posting strategy over time. Utilizing popular trends and hashtags during your scheduled posts can also boost visibility, making it easier for users to discover your content organically.

In conclusion, understanding optimal posting times and maintaining a consistent schedule are fundamental aspects of a successful TikTok strategy in Canada. By applying these practices, creators can enhance their chances of producing viral content and expanding their follower base significantly.

Measuring Success and Adjusting Strategy

In the dynamic environment of TikTok Canada, measuring the success of your content is essential for adjusting strategies and enhancing your growth trajectory. Utilizing TikTok’s built-in analytics tools allows creators to gather valuable insights into their performance metrics. These metrics include views, likes, shares, and comments, which help paint a clear picture of how well your content resonates with your audience.

By regularly reviewing these analytics, creators can identify which types of content perform best. For instance, you may find that humorous videos yield more engagement than educational pieces. This data-driven approach enables you to pivot your content strategy accordingly. If a particular trend or hashtag drives higher engagement, consider producing more content that aligns with it to capitalize on this momentum.

Moreover, analyzing your follower demographics can provide opportunities for targeted content creation. Understanding the age, location, and interests of your audience allows you to tailor your messages and visuals to their preferences, increasing the likelihood of shares and re-engagement. When tracking performance, also take note of the times when your videos gain the most traction; this information can guide you in scheduling future posts for maximum visibility.

Continuous improvement is key in the fast-changing landscape of TikTok Canada. By employing data from your analytics, you can test different formats and styles to see what works best. For example, experimenting with various video lengths or branching out into trending challenges can lead to new audience engagement. Successful creators make informed decisions based on performance metrics, enabling them to refine their content strategies and increase followers steadily.
